  • The Danish Music Museum (Danish: Musikmuseet; formerly Musikhistorsik Museum and Carl Claudius Samling) is located in Rosenørns Alle 22 in Copenhagen, Denmark.
  • The Danish Music Museum will reopen 12th of September in the Copenhagen Conservatory, Rosenørns Allé 22, Frederiksberg.
  • Furthermore, The Danish Music Museum includes a library and archive of items especially related to instruments and Danish music life.
